Mobile VR Games: The Casual Powerhouse

Examples: Oculus Quest, Pico, Mobile AR Devices

Mobile VR has seen explosive growth thanks to its affordability and convenience. Devices like Meta Quest (formerly Oculus Quest), Pico, and mobile AR-enabled phones allow users to step into virtual worlds without high-end gaming PCs or expensive consoles.

The Advantages of Mobile VR

One of the strongest draws of mobile VR is accessibility. These systems are wireless, lightweight, and often don’t need external sensors or long setup times. That makes them perfect for fitness games, social VR spaces, and casual or puzzle-based games.

Another massive benefit is cost-effectiveness. Development costs are typically lower than console/PC VR because the hardware is more standardized. There’s also a lower barrier to entry for users, which means a broader potential player base.

Mobile VR also supports faster iteration. You can prototype and test more quickly, push updates easily, and reach users without going through long console approval processes.

The Trade-Offs

Of course, with accessibility comes trade-offs. Mobile VR hardware still has limited processing power compared to high-end PCs or consoles. That means lower resolution, simpler interactions, and fewer simultaneous assets.

While mobile VR is fantastic for casual experiences, it may not be ideal if your vision includes realistic physics, high-fidelity graphics, or massive open worlds.

Interaction design is also more limited. Most mobile VR platforms use controller-free hand tracking or simplified motion controllers, which can restrict gameplay complexity.

Console and PC VR Games: Premium, Powerful, and Niche

Examples: PlayStation VR2, SteamVR, Valve Index

Console and PC-based VR games remain the pinnacle of immersive gaming. These platforms offer the highest levels of visual fidelity, performance, and sensory input, perfect for genres that rely on speed, accuracy, and atmosphere.

Games like Half-Life: Alyx, Gran Turismo 7 VR, or No Man’s Sky VR wouldn’t be possible on mobile systems. They require the horsepower of gaming PCs or dedicated consoles and take full advantage of high-end headsets and accessories.

The Strengths of Console/PC VR

If your game demands realism, immersion, or complexity, console/PC VR is where you want to be. Features like eye tracking, full-body tracking, haptic feedback, and expansive modding capabilities allow for vibrant gameplay.

The audience here is more hardcore and invested. They’re often willing to spend more time and money on in-depth experiences and care deeply about story, visuals, and mechanics.

Console VR also benefits from better peripherals and network support, which makes it the go-to platform for competitive games, co-op adventures, and experimental genres like VR horror or simulation.

The Limitations

The downside? It’s expensive. This is not just for players who need a headset, a console, and accessories, but also for developers. You’ll face higher production costs, longer development cycles, and tougher quality control from platform holders like Sony or Valve.

The audience is also smaller. These users are dedicated, yes, but they don’t represent the broad mass of casual gamers you’d find on mobile VR or AR platforms.

So, if your business model depends on quick scaling or casual adoption, console/PC VR may not be your ideal first step.

How to Choose the Right VR Platform

Ultimately, choosing between mobile VR and console/PC VR comes down to understanding three main things: your audience, your budget, and your game’s core concept.

1. Audience Demographics

Who are you building for? If your target players are first-time VR users, mobile VR is a natural fit. But if you’re targeting VR veterans, eSports players, or cinematic enthusiasts, console/PC VR will offer them the depth they expect.

Age, tech literacy, and gaming preferences all matter. A VR meditation app for seniors? Go mobile. A competitive shooter with voice chat and map-based strategy? PC VR is your playground.

2. Budget and Timeline

Mobile VR allows you to develop faster and test more quickly. It’s ideal for startups, indie studios, and companies trying out VR for the first time. Console VR, by contrast, may need more time and team power, especially in animation, environment design, and QA testing.

Don’t just think about development. Think about marketing, support, updates, and expansion. Does your budget support ongoing optimization? Will you port later or stay exclusive?

3. Gameplay Complexity

What is your game really about? Simple mini-games, narrative exploration, or social hangouts thrive in mobile VR. On the other hand, if your gameplay relies on environmental storytelling, real-time physics, or layered mechanics, you’ll need the power of console/PC VR.

Case Studies: Matching Game Design to Platform

Let’s explore how different types of games succeed on the right platforms.

Case Study 1: A Mobile VR Fitness App

Imagine a VR game designed to get people moving, something like FitXR or Supernatural. The design focuses on simplicity, rhythm, and daily motivation. Mobile VR is the perfect choice.

The user doesn’t need long sessions or super-high-end graphics. What they need is smooth performance, intuitive interaction, and comfort. This project can be built faster, released to a wider audience, and updated frequently with new workouts or music tracks.

Case Study 2: AAA VR Shooter for PC

Now, picture a narrative-rich, futuristic shooter with environmental puzzles and reactive AI, something like Boneworks or Half-Life: Alyx. This is a premium console/PC VR experience.

You’ll need advanced shaders, dynamic lighting, and precision controls. Multiplayer would require a robust backend. The platform investment is bigger, but so is the potential for awards, media buzz, and higher-priced sales.

Both projects are valid, but only when matched to the right tech and audience.

Q1. What’s the difference between mobile VR and console/PC VR game development?

Mobile VR focuses on accessible, wireless experiences with lower hardware requirements, ideal for casual games. Console/PC VR supports high-end graphics and complex mechanics, suitable for immersive, in-depth gameplay.

Q2. Which VR platform is better for beginners?

Mobile VR is better for beginners due to its affordability, ease of use, and minimal setup. It’s perfect for first-time users and casual players.

Q3. Is mobile VR game development cheaper than console VR?

Yes, mobile VR development usually costs less because of simpler hardware, faster development cycles, and fewer approval barriers compared to console or PC platforms.

Q4. What kind of games work best on console or PC VR?

Games that need high realism, precision, or advanced visuals like shooters, simulations, or horror titles perform best on console or PC VR platforms.
